Identification and Background

The third generation iPod nano, released September 2007, is a radical departure from the first two nano generations. Its short and wide anodized aluminum case came in lighter color shades and allowed for a large 2" display. Two versions were offered, in 4 and 8 GB capacities, and they remain as the heaviest nano generation yet produced.
